ABOUT THE ROLE
As an Admin Assistant at a Barchester care home, you’ll carry out a range of responsibilities to help us deliver the quality care and support our residents deserve. In this varied role, we’ll need you to answer the phone, handle our files and support our managers. You’ll also meet and greet visitors, engage with residents and show prospective clients and their families around so they can see what makes us so different. Across everything you do as an Admin Assistant here, you’ll go out of your way to help us create a vibrant, happy environment.

ABOUT YOU
If you have the ability to multi-task, good computer skills and a confident telephone manner you could be well-suited to the Admin Assistant role with us. It’s also really important that you’re a people person – you’ll take a genuine interest in our residents and their families. If that sounds like you, we’ll give you the opportunity to develop your skills with courses that have been designed to build your confidence across all your responsibilities.
